Bayley has had issues with Piper Niven in the past. The Scottish star has attacked the Role Model and laid her out on multiple occasions. This led Niven to get a title match against the WWE Women's Champion at Clash at the Castle. However, Piper Niven came up short in the match. Just when the Role Model thought that she was done with Niven and Chelsea Green, she ran into them tonight.

On tonight's episode of WWE SmackDown, Bayley was offering some advice for the Money in the Bank ladder match participants when Chelsea Green interrupted her. She claimed that the only reason the Role Model is still champion is because Green was ejected from Piper Niven's match. She then proclaimed that she was going to win the Money in the Bank ladder match.
The WWE Women's Champion asked her to first win a match. Just then, Niven attacked her from behind. Green warned the champion that the next time Piper attacked her, she would cash in her Money in the Bank briefcase.
